Game Date: 1968/06/01 Cleveland Indians vs Washington Senators
Played at Cleveland Stadium with 5614 people in attendance.
Opponents | 123456789 | Runs | Hits | Errors | |
Cleveland Indians | 000010010 | 2 | 9 | 0 | |
Washington Senators | 100104000 | 6 | 10 | 0 | |
Teams | # Pitchers | Starting Pitcher | Manager | ||
Cleveland Indians - | 3 | Stan Williams | Alvin Dark | ||
Washington Senators - | 2 | Dick Bosman | Jim Lemon | ||
Home Runs in game: | |||||
Cleveland Indians - | 0 | ||||
Washington Senators - | 2 | ||||
